Sorry. Maybe I wasn't asking my question right. I wanted to know if I could use the COUPON when buying the Disney gift card. I think everyone thought I was asking if I could use the $10 Target GIFT CARD to buy the first Disney card. The coupon is/was to receive a $10 gift card for every $50 purchase. So the answer is yes, in the first transaction, buy a $50 Disney card and redeem the coupon for a $10 Target gift card. Then in the second transaction, use that $10 card toward the purchase of the second Disney gift card and so on.
